Abstrakt: The operation of the executive bodies of soil and soil-cultivating equipment (for example, the teeth of excavator buckets) is often accompanied by the formation and development of local wear, which is the cause of destruction. Meanwhile, well-known theoretical studies devoted to the study of working conditions and forecasting the resource of such parts are few and are of a private nature, stipulated by the solution of specific problems. This article deals with cantilever-fixed parts in the case of prevailing wear in local areas of the working surface. A rectangular cantilever fixed beam subjected to bending with a section where a groove simulating wear is located is considered as a calculation model. It has been established that the working state of a cantilever-fixed part with the presence of local wear is determined by a system of inequalities relating its geometry to the allowable stresses and pressure of the wear medium. A mathematical model has been obtained facilitating prediction of the resource of a part as its wear develops.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
